Blackburn Canal
Balustrade Project – Blackburn
This project exemplifies F.H.Brundle’s commitment to providing a complete solution for all decking and balustrade needs. Located on the picturesque Blackburn canal, the project demanded specific materials to withstand the waterside environment.
Composite Boards: The Perfect Choice
Traditional timber decking wouldn’t suffice due to its susceptibility to water absorption, rot, and warping, but composite boards provided the ideal solution. These low-maintenance, mould-resistant boards offered superior durability against water and environmental wear.
Complementing the View: Glass Balustrade
For an elegant and unobstructed view of the canal, the project incorporated approximately 18 linear metres of glass balustrade. This system utilised 10mm toughened monolithic standard glass panels. The posts were constructed from high-grade 42.4mm stainless steel 316, ideal for external applications due to its superior corrosion resistance. All posts were mid, end, and corner pre-assembled with plain top designs, creating a clean and modern aesthetic.
